Uploaded image for project: 'PUBLIC - Liferay Portal Community Edition'
  1. PUBLIC - Liferay Portal Community Edition
  2. LPS-83597

EntityCacheImpl and FinderCacheImpl can not remove cache from internal map when the cache is removed from cache manager

    Details

      Description

      EntityCacheImpl and FinderCacheImpl use class names as keys for their internal map of caches, but register caches to the cache manager with prefixes added to class names.

      When a cache is removed from the manager, EntityCacheImpl and FinderCacheImpl are notified with the portal cache name which has the prefix.

      Both use the name directly to remove the cache from the internal map, which will not work due to the prefix.

        Attachments

          Activity

            People

            Assignee:
            brian.chan Brian Chan
            Reporter:
            dante.wang Dante Wang
            Participants of an Issue:
            Recent user:
            Brian Wulbern
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:
              Days since last comment:
              3 years, 13 weeks, 4 days ago

                Packages

                Version Package
                7.1.1 CE GA2
                7.1.X
                Master